- Details on results:
- - Retention times of reference substances used for calibration: see table below
- Details of fitted regression line: log k' = 0.479 x log Pow – 1.466 (r = 0.96, n=14)
- Graph of regression line and chromatograms: see attachment
- The chromatogram of test substance showed one major peak (96% area) and several small peaks. The log Pow for the major peak was reported as the log Pow for ROC-118. See attachment.
- Average retention data for test item: see table below
- The value of log Pow obtained from duplicate measurements was within ± 0.1 log units.

Applicant's summary and conclusion
- Conclusions:
- The log Pow of the substance was determined to be 5.1 (HPLC method).
- Executive summary:
The log Pow of the substance was determined using the HPLC method in a GLP study according to EC A.8, OECD 117 and OPPTS 830.7570. Formamide was used as unretained substance. Duplicate injections of unretained substance, reference substances and test item were made in an UPLC system. The mobile phase was 75/25 (v/v) methanol/water and the wavelength of detection was 210 nm for the unretained substances as well as the reference substances, and 257 nm for the test item and blank solution. The chromatogram of the test item showed 1 major and several small peaks. The log Pow values for the peaks with area of 96% and 3.2% were determined to be 5.1 and 4.2, resp. The log Pow of the substance is thus 5.1.
